Why would I want to use a hang tag?
Many manufacturers produce products and materials where labels cannot be easily applied. Hang tags are still one of the most efficient marking systems, especially since they can carry bar coding and jumbo numbering. Hangs tags are versatile in that they can be small or large, hang by string or wire, hang on door knobs or rear view mirrors and can be used just about anywhere.


What stock is normally used?
We have a variety of materials available from coated to uncoated materials, from 28# ledger to 200# basis weights, from paper to synthetic, from thermal transfer to Tyvek® or Kimdura® and more. You can even use special order materials if needed.


What methods of fastening are available?
We can provide you with string ties, wire ties, notch die cutting for doorknobs or rear view mirrors and other special die cutting to fit your clients' needs.


How are hang tags printed?
In the manufacturing process they may be printed offset, flexographic, digital or crash imprinted depending on the application and quantity.


What types of printers can be used?
In the field, hang tags may be printed on dot matrix, laser or thermal printers. Often they are hand completed. As with all of our products, it is very important for us to know the type of printer you will be using so we can use the correct materials in the manufacturing process.
